Kastheria Rajpoot refers to a group within the Rajput community, primarily found in northern India. This community is known for its historical significance as warriors and rulers in various princely states. The term "Kastheria" often signifies a specific sub-clan or lineage within the broader Rajput classification, which encompasses various clans with distinct traditions and heritage. Rajputs, including those from the Kastheria lineage, are celebrated for their valor, chivalry, and contribution to Indian history.
